As the only true Christmas episode in the Buffy canon, trades typical holiday cheer for a haunting exploration of guilt, redemption, and the weight of the past. Written and directed by Joss Whedon, this episode serves as a pivotal bridge for Angel’s journey toward his own spinoff series. Haunted by the Unforgivable
